Best Times of Year to Explore Newcastle, Texas

Newcastle, Texas, has a humid subtropical climate so that you can enjoy all four seasons, each with its own atmosphere. In summer, it can get pretty hot, with temperatures reaching up to 96 °F. But this is a great time for water activities at Lake Mineral Wells State Park, where visitors can go kayaking and cool off in the water. On the flip side, winter is milder, with highs dropping into the 50s and lows dropping to around 29°F in January. This cooler weather is perfect for exploring Fort Belknap and taking peaceful walks on its historical trails. But the best times to explore Newcastle are spring and fall. During these seasons, the weather is just right—mild and comfy for outdoor adventures or enjoying fun local events. Plan Your Day: Fun Activities in Newcastle, Texas

Newcastle, Texas, is a great spot for those searching for a mix of history and outdoor fun. One of the best places to explore here is Lake Mineral Wells State Park, which is located only a short ride away. This destination is perfect for anyone who loves being outside. There, visitors can enjoy kayaking on calm waters, hiking along beautiful trails, or even try rock climbing for those feeling adventurous. It's a terrific spot for those who enjoy staying active and soaking in nature. Then there's the historic Fort Belknap, which is a must-see for history buffs interested in the history of the Texas frontier. Meanwhile, the area around the fort is lovely for taking a walk and spotting some local wildlife, making for a peaceful day out. Golf enthusiasts will love the nearby Olney Country Club, which offers a laid-back yet engaging experience for both locals and visitors. The club is perfect for a leisurely afternoon of golf amidst scenic views of the Texas countryside. Throughout the year, the club hosts a variety of events and tournaments that are open to everyone, providing a perfect opportunity to make new friends.
